- USDT’s $4B supply drop suggests investors are keeping less capital in crypto.
- USDC is also shrinking, pointing to weaker stablecoin demand, not just rotation.
- Tron remains a stablecoin growth leader, adding billions despite broader weakness.
USDT’s supply has fallen sharply in recent weeks, raising questions about whether investors are pulling money from crypto markets.
Green Dot founder Stacy Muur pointed to the decline after CryptoQuant reported a $4 billion drop in USDT’s 60-day supply. “Wtf is happening to the USDT supply?” Muur wrote.
Muur said about $870 million in USDT supply disappeared over 11 days. The stablecoin’s 60-day change fell to minus $4 billion, while its market capitalization dropped to about $183 billion.
